Re: KDCA Washington National MSFS
Hi, which version have you installed?
In v1.4 we fixed the docking issues. This update fixed all animated jetways, which became not operational due to former sim updates, but it was in 2023. There are 60 stands in KDCA but 7-8 are inactive because they are occupied by static aircraft.

Re: KDCA Washington National MSFS
Dear Frank, can you post some screenshots, please? Otherwise, it's hard to understand where the problem is.
But firstly, please let us know if you did some basic steps before you tried to reinstall the scenery:
-> Clear SceneryIndexes Cache - the simulator will rebuild the indexes automatically during the next start.
-> Set the scenery priority
-> Isolation of conflicting add-on
